Multiple people electrocuted in south St. Louis

ST. LOUIS — Officials rushed four people to the hospital after being shocked by electricity Sunday night, KSDK reports.

According to the St. Louis Fire Department, the incident happened at around 8:30 p.m. near the intersection of Louisiana Avenue and Montana Street.

All the victims were adults, the fire department said. The cause of the injuries is not known but officials said thunderstorms were moving through the area around the same time.
